Comparable Facts

  • Johnson University is larger than than Allen University based on total student enrollment (950 students vs. 677 students)

Allen University vs. Johnson University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Allen University or Johnson University?

  • Johnson University is 47% more expensive to attend than Allen University for in-state tuition ($18,428.00 vs. $12,540.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 47% higher at Johnson University than Allen University ($18,428.00 vs. $12,540.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Allen University than Johnson University ($11,058 vs. $20,713)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Allen University are 8.1% lower than costs at Johnson University ($8,584 vs. $9,278)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Allen University than Johnson University (97% vs. 94%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Allen University students is 40.4% larger than aid received Johnson University ($13,755 vs. $9,797)

Allen University vs. Johnson University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Allen University or Johnson University?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Johnson University and Allen University.

  • Graduates from Johnson University earn on average $6,800 more per year than Allen University graduates after ten years. ($31,100 vs. $24,300)
  • Johnson University students graduate with a $15,739 lower median federal student loan debt than Allen University graduates. ($21,380 vs. $37,119)
  • Johnson University graduates are paying $162 less per month on federal student loans than Allen University graduates. ($221 vs. $383)
  • More Johnson University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Allen University students, three years after graduation. (64% vs. 13%)
